Cardinal Lawrence is tasked with leading one of the world's most secretive and ancient events by selecting a new Pope. When the most powerful leaders of the Catholic Church gather from all over the world and lock themselves in the Vatican halls, Lawrence finds himself in the midst of a conspiracy and uncovers a secret that could shake the foundations of the Church.
